System requirements
Minimum
- CPU
- 2.0 Ghz Dual-Core CPU
- GPU
- ATI Radeon HD 2600 or better / NVIDIA GeForce 8600 or better, 512 MB video memory, with Shader Model 3 support
- RAM
- 3 GB RAM
- DirectX
- Version 9.0
- Storage
- 20 GB available space
- Network
- Broadband Internet connection
- Sound
- DirectSound-compatible sound device
- OS *
- Windows 7 (SP1) 64-Bit
Recommended
- CPU
- Intel Core i5 or AMD Quad-Core or better
- GPU
- NVIDIA GeForce GTX 260 or AMD Radeon HD 4770 or better (1GB VRAM)
- RAM
- 4 GB RAM
- DirectX
- Version 9.0
- Storage
- 20 GB available space
- Network
- Broadband Internet connection
- Sound
- DirectSound-compatible sound device
- OS *
- Windows 7 (SP1) / Windows 8.1 / Windows 10 64-Bit
